DELICIOUS RUM BALLS (NO-BAKE!)

These Rum Balls are so good! But bear in mind, these are not baked, so no alcohol cooks away... These are NOT for the kiddos! Bring a batch of these to a Christmas party...(Not for a Church social!)

Steps:

  • 1. In a food processor or electric chopper, blend up Vanilla Wafers (or Graham Crackers) until it reaches a mealy consistency. Add all ingredients together in a bowl, except powdered sugar. Roll them into pecan or walnut-sized balls. If they are too dry, add a tiny bit more corn syrup, or if too moist and are hard to form, add a little more processed vanilla wafers. When rolled to the size you want, roll in powdered sugar.
  • 2. This makes about 2 dozen balls.(Don't make them too big!) Cover and refrigerate until serving. These can also be made without the liquor so kids can enjoy them. May have to add more prepared wafers to make up for the omitted liquid.
  • 3. If you are taking these to a party, one batch may not be enough! Note: For a more interesting taste, use coffee liquer, or a peppermint, or butterscotch schnapps for the flavor instead of rum or bourbon, whiskey, etc. Warning!! Don't eat too many of these and drive! During the Holidays and always, eat and drink responsibly anything containing alcohol! Happy Holidays and Bon Apetit' Y'all!

2 c vanilla wafers (graham crackers are just as good!)
1 c chopped nuts (pecans or walnuts)
1 c powdered sugar
2 Tbsp cocoa powder
2 Tbsp white corn syrup
1/3 c rum (spiced rum is okay) may also use brandy, bourbon, or a canadian blended whiskey

RUM BALLS

Treat your near and dear ones these delicious sugar coated candies made with rum and nuts - a traditional holiday dessert.

Steps:

  • In large bowl, mix crushed cookies, almonds and 2 cups powdered sugar. Stir in rum and corn syrup. Shape mixture into 1-inch balls.
  • In small bowl, place 1/2 cup powdered sugar. Roll balls in powdered sugar. Store in tightly covered container at least 5 days before serving to develop flavor but no longer than 4 weeks.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 70, Carbohydrate 10 g, Cholesterol 0 mg, Fat 1/2, Fiber 0 g, Protein 1 g, SaturatedFat 0 g, ServingSize 1 Candy, Sodium 25 mg, Sugar 7 g, TransFat 0 g

1 package (9 oz) thin chocolate wafer cookies, finely crushed (about 2 cups)
2 cups finely chopped almonds, pecans or walnuts
2 cups powdered sugar
1/4 cup light rum
1/4 cup light corn syrup
1/2 cup powdered sugar

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, stir together the crushed vanilla wafers, 3/4 cup confectioners' sugar, cocoa, and nuts. Blend in corn syrup and rum.
  • Shape into 1 inch balls, and roll in additional confectioners' sugar. Store in an airtight container for several days to develop the flavor. Roll again in confectioners' sugar before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 98.8 calories, Carbohydrate 12.3 g, Fat 4.8 g, Fiber 0.6 g, Protein 1.2 g, SaturatedFat 0.9 g, Sodium 38.3 mg, Sugar 2.3 g

3 ¼ cups crushed vanilla wafers
¾ cup confectioners' sugar
¼ cup unsweetened cocoa powder
1 ½ cups chopped walnuts
3 tablespoons light corn syrup
½ cup rum

RUMMY YUMMY RUM BALLS

If you can't stand waiting for cookies to bake and cool, speed up your sugar rush by sticking with no-bake cookies. These easy Holiday classics are exceptionally versatile. They can be made from any variety of rum, including spiced, dark and even coconut. Also vanilla or chocolate wafers work equally well. This recipe produces a particularly rummy rum ball. For a lighter touch, just ease off on the rum!!

Steps:

  • In a food processor, pulse pecans until finely ground. Add cookies and pulse until ground. Add remaining ingredients and pulse until thoroughly mixed.
  • Roll mixture into small balls, then decorate by rolling in colored sugars.
  • Store in airtight containers.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 55.2, Fat 3.3, SaturatedFat 0.4, Cholesterol 0.1, Sodium 24.7, Carbohydrate 5.2, Fiber 0.5, Sugar 2.6, Protein 0.7

8 ounces pecans, toasted and cooled
1 (9 ounce) package chocolate wafer cookies or 1 (9 ounce) package vanilla wafer cookies
1/2 cup powdered sugar
2 tablespoons cocoa
1/2 cup rum
2 tablespoons corn syrup
1 orange, zest of
colored sugar sprinkle (granulated sugar can be substituted)
